Transaction 64dfc846090df3d2ae15524fde8c390fcc55bd37c17ab8c510ee97595b37aeb3

1 Input
2 Outputs
  • 64dfc846090df3d2ae15524fde8c390fcc55bd37c17ab8c510ee97595b37aeb3:0
  • value  101929
    address  32wAzsvC2y4uEWEfDy5QJ9Xdeifq5q7Kwu
  • 64dfc846090df3d2ae15524fde8c390fcc55bd37c17ab8c510ee97595b37aeb3:1
  • value  1600000
    address  3KECQuuGYRYxEkcbeGzS7gvc62j3Mm9jD3